FREEDOM SCHOOLS SERVANT LEADER INTERN (SUMMER 2026) Partnership with Children works with public schools in New York City’s highest-need communities to provide critical social and emotional supports for the hardest-to-reach youth and to systematically build schools that are safe, successful and conducive to learning. Partnership with Children will implement the Children’s Defense Fund (CDF) Freedom Schools® program in one of our partner schools in Brownsville, Brooklyn during the summer of 2026. The CDF Freedom Schools® program is an educational and cultural enrichment summer program that promotes family and community involvement. The program serves children in grades 1st through 5th for six weeks. The activity-based program integrates reading, conflict resolution, and social action, and is designed to promote social, cultural, and historical awareness. College-age young people and recent college graduates play a key role in the CDF Freedom Schools® program as Servant Leader Interns (paid summer staff). Servant Leaders are responsible for the front-line care and supervision of the summer program participants. They serve as facilitators in the classroom and as leaders of parent workshops and community outreach activities.
